I would argue a 3 jaw is probably the cause of the runout, you've done pretty well as it is to eliminate that much runout.
Think about it, the jaws are never going to register an absolutely true position on a self centre chuck. The only way to do this is to use a 4 jaw or between centres turning.
Moving the tailstock from left to right will only eliminate any relative bias on that axis. On a self centre fixing, the tailstock can only be used to offer support for an unsupported part, to a decent degree of accuracy, but cannot offer total accuracy.
What makes the conundrum worse is that if you centre drilled the part in the 3 jaw, that will also reflect any corresponding chuck runout when tested on the bar's outer unmachined surface.
Silver steel is a better material than mild to test onto because it's often purchase precision ground.
